  5. The official home of climt, a Python based climate modelling ... - GitHub

    climt is a Toolkit for building Earth system models in Python. climt stands for Climate Modelling and Diagnostics Toolkit -- it is meant both for creating models and for generating diagnostics (radiative fluxes for an atmospheric column, for example).

  7. SimMod: A simple python based climate model - Berkeley Earth

    Jun 7, 2016 · In order for researchers to easily translate emissions of CO 2, CH 4, and N 2 O into future warming consistent at a global level with the results obtained from the latest generation of climate models, we have developed a simple python-based climate model we call SimMod (available on github here).
